Ever fixed something and don't know how you did it? Well just had one of those moments. I have a PURE Highway DAB radio in my Zed with an active screen antenna. But I have never been able to get the DAB side of the radio to scan for stations, it always said on the screen no signal, but this was not an issue because the FM side worked just fine (but I have always been a bit hacked off it didn't work if I was honest
) So it was on the list of jobs to remove the radio at some point and check all the connections etc etc.
Well as I fitted my new steering wheel the other day I had to disconnect the battery so I didn't end up with a face full of airbag when I disconnected it from the steering wheel (thank you again @Mint for the advice
) well, all went well with that modification but I remembered today I hadn't changed the radio and analog clock back to the correct times following the radio disconnection and being a bit OCD though I'd just pop out and sort that.
Sooo turned on the radio to adjust the clock and it started up in DAB mode, tuned its self in and bingo I now have a fully working DAB stereo
Haven't got a clue why disconnecting the battery sorted, unless it did a factory reset? So next time our IT department tell me to "ToTo" my laptop when it plays up I wont take the p*** out of them.
